Be prepared to cry. Listen to lawyer and writer, Jon Henes, as he discusses the devastating impact of his mother's Alzheimer's disease. His essays on Medium.com about it are deeply moving, beautiful and poignant. Our conversation touches on life and death, the soul, parenting, family, love and what it means to remember.
